THE JUBILEE SINGERS.
The representative of the Jubilee Singers (MrS. Churchill Otton)|arrived in Hamilton yesterday, and as will be seen by a notice in this issue, they will open their season in Waikato at Cambridge on Thursday evening next in the Public Hall, and on the following evening the talented company will give an entertainment in the Volunteer Hall, Hamilton. Many of our readers will remember the two previous visits of theFisk Jubilee Singers in former years, and the novel and delightful evenings that were spent in liscening to their performances. In the reports referring to the company we notice that the present combination contains only nno of the original Fisk Company (Mr Orpheus McAdoo), the director of the present one. Our evening contemporary in dealing wilh the concert given on Boxing night amongst other equally favourable comments says : —'"The united volume of sound could be compared to nothing but the tones of a superior pipe organ. But it was not only the blending of the voices that secured the singers the tributes of praise they receivod from the audience, it was as much as anything the capital balance of parts maintained. Part singing is the company's forte, though the solos interspersed between the choruses are exceedingly high-class efforts. The end, with the glee " Good-night, Beloved " (Pinsuti), came all too soon, the two hours having slipped away unnoticed. It was a rich, musical treat from beginning to end, and the Company is certainly the best that has visittd Auckland for some time."
